How to Find the Right Girl: Proven Steps to Meaningful Connection

Finding the right girl starts with clarity about who you are and what you truly want in a long term partner. When your values, goals, and lifestyle align with hers, everyday moments feel more supportive and less like a constant compromise.

This guide breaks the process into practical steps, from self reflection to real world interaction and careful evaluation. Use these sections as a roadmap to increase your chances of building a healthy, lasting connection.

Understanding Yourself First

Before you search for the right girl, it is essential to understand your own needs, boundaries, and long term vision for life. Clarity about your career plans, family intentions, and emotional expectations helps you communicate honestly and avoid mismatches.

Take time to journal your non negotiables and flexible preferences. This self work reduces impulsive decisions and ensures that you seek a partner who complements rather than completes you.

Define Your Core Priorities

Write down three to five values that must align, such as honesty, ambition, or kindness. When these core priorities are clear, you can quickly filter out connections that do not fit your long term goals.

Set Realistic Standards

Balance ideals with reality by distinguishing between must haves and nice to haves. Flexible areas like hobbies or style can broaden your options, while non negotiables like trust and respect protect your future happiness.

Building Confidence and Social Skills

Confidence is attractive because it signals self awareness and reliability. When you feel comfortable in your own skin, you listen better, express interest clearly, and handle rejection with grace.

Practice simple social drills, such as maintaining eye contact, asking open ended questions, and sharing brief personal stories. These habits make everyday interaction feel more natural and help you build rapport quickly.

Practice Active Listening

Show genuine interest by reflecting back what she says and asking follow up questions. Active listening demonstrates respect and uncovers deeper compatibility in topics like family, work, and ambitions.

Develop Healthy Boundaries

State your limits calmly and early, whether they relate to time, values, or emotional availability. Clear boundaries attract partners who appreciate you for who you are and reduce the risk of one sided relationships.

Finding Opportunities to Meet People

Expanding your social circle increases the pool of people you can connect with in meaningful ways. Focus on environments where shared interests make conversation easy and authentic.

Mix online and offline approaches, such as hobby classes, volunteer work, and community events. Quality interactions in these spaces often lead to friendships and, sometimes, romantic possibilities.

Join Interest Based Groups

Clubs, workshops, or sports teams centered around your passions create natural opportunities to meet like minded people. Common activities give you topics to discuss and reduce the pressure of forced socializing.

Use Digital Tools Thoughtfully

Dating apps and social platforms can introduce you to diverse profiles when used with intention. Set specific goals, such as meeting for coffee after a few messages, and prioritize safety and honest communication.

How She Behaves Under Pressure

Observe how she handles stress, conflict, and everyday responsibilities. Patterns of resilience, empathy, and accountability are strong indicators of long term reliability and emotional health.

Notice whether she communicates calmly during disagreement and follows through on commitments. These behaviors reflect maturity and suggest she is capable of sustaining a stable relationship.

Conflict Resolution Style

Watch for openness to compromise and willingness to apologize when appropriate. A partner who avoids blame and focuses on solutions contributes to peaceful, long term partnerships.

Responsibility and Integrity

Reliability in small matters, such as punctuality and honesty about plans, often predicts trustworthiness in major life decisions. Consistency over time is more meaningful than occasional grand gestures.

FAQ

Reader questions

How do I know if we share long term compatibility?

Discuss future plans, family values, and financial goals openly. Compatibility is evident when your visions for life align and both partners feel respected, even when opinions differ.

What are realistic timelines for building a serious connection?

Every relationship develops at its own pace, but mutual interest, consistent communication, and shared activities typically signal readiness for commitment within a few months.

Should I prioritize emotional connection or shared interests first?

Emotional connection tends to matter more for long term satisfaction, while shared interests enhance day to day joy. Aim for a balance that supports both intimacy and enjoyable time together.

How can I avoid misreading signals of interest?

Look for consistent actions over time, such as making plans, active communication, and vulnerability. When words and behaviors align, interest is more likely to be genuine.
